react-native-status-bar-color
v1.0.1
Published
A small bridge to change status bar and navigation bar color in native android code. In case of iOS, it uses React Native's Status bar class to set up the status bar tint.
Downloads
4
Readme
react-native-status-bar-color
Getting started
$ npm install react-native-status-bar-color --save
Mostly automatic installation
$ react-native link react-native-status-bar-color
Manual installation
Android
- Open up
android/app/src/main/java/[...]/MainActivity.java
- Add
import com.ninthsemeter.reactnative.statusBarColor.RNStatusBarColorPackage;
to the imports at the top of the file - Add
new RNStatusBarColorPackage()
to the list returned by thegetPackages()
method
- Append the following lines to
android/settings.gradle
:include ':react-native-status-bar-color' project(':react-native-status-bar-color').projectDir = new File(rootProject.projectDir, '../node_modules/react-native-status-bar-color/android')
- Insert the following lines inside the dependencies block in
android/app/build.gradle
:compile project(':react-native-status-bar-color')
Usage
import RNStatusBarColor from 'react-native-status-bar-color';
// TODO: What to do with the module?
RNStatusBarColor;